How Does the Agricultural Grain Harvester Reversing Gearbox Work?

The for agricultural grain harvesting plays a critical role in the machine's operation by transferring power from the engine to various mechanical components that execute the harvesting process. Here's a step-by-step explanation of how the gearbox functions:

  1. Power Input: The process begins when the combine harvester's engine generates mechanical power. This power is directed into the gearbox through the input shaft.
  2. Gear Engagement: Within the gearbox, there are multiple gears of different sizes and ratios. These gears engage depending on the gear selected by the operator.
  3. Speed and Torque Conversion: As the selected gears engage, they modify the engine's input speed and torque to a more suitable output for the task at hand.
  4. Power Output: The transformed power is delivered from the gearbox to the harvester's operational components via the output shaft.
  5. Operational Control: The gearbox integrates with other control systems in the combine harvester, such as the clutch and hydraulic systems.

Proper Maintenance of Agricultural Grain Harvester Reversing Gearbox

Proper maintenance of the combine harvester gearbox is crucial to ensure optimal performance, longevity, and safety of the machinery. Here's a detailed guide on maintaining the gearbox of a grain harvester:

  1. Regular Lubrication: One of the most critical aspects of gearbox maintenance is ensuring that it is adequately lubricated.
  2. Inspect and Replace Worn Gears: Regularly inspect the gears within the gearbox for signs of wear, such as pitting, scoring, or chipping.
  3. Check and Maintain Bearings: Bearings are pivotal for reducing friction and enabling smooth operation of moving components within the gearbox.
  4. Ensure Proper Alignment and Tightening: Misalignment of the gearbox can cause uneven load distribution and increased wear.
  5. Monitor and Maintain Seals and Gaskets: Seals and gaskets prevent the ingress of contaminants such as dirt, dust, and water.
  6. Regular Cleaning: Keeping the gearbox clean is essential for preventing overheating and the accumulation of debris that can lead to wear and malfunction.

Choose the Right Agricultural Grain Harvester Reversing Gearbox

Choosing the right gearbox for a grain harvester is crucial for achieving optimal performance, efficiency, and longevity of your agricultural machinery. Here are some detailed points to consider when selecting a combine harvester gearbox:

  1. Torque and Power Capacity: Assess the power output and torque requirements of your harvester's engine.
  2. Gear Ratios and Speed Variability: The gearbox should offer a range of gear ratios that provide the necessary speed adjustments for different harvesting conditions.
  3. Durability and Material Quality: Since the gearbox will be exposed to harsh environmental conditions, it is crucial to select one made from high-quality, durable materials.
  4. Ease of Maintenance and Repair: Consider the maintenance requirements of the gearbox.
  5. Compatibility with Harvester: The gearbox must be compatible with your specific model of grain harvester.
